Optimizing Paper Tracking
By Lisa Cross -- Graphic Arts Online, 10/1/2008
KBA has developed a wireless identification system that automatically provides accurate, real-time data on the location of paper pallets. The PileTronic is based on the Siemens Simatic RF600 RFID sensor system.
When paper is delivered, two Simatic RF630L smart labels (below) are affixed on the pallet; the labels transmit an identification number to an RF660R read/write device via a wireless ultrahigh-frequency (UHF) band (between 865 and 868 MHz in Europe; 902 and 928 MHz in the U.S.). Incoming goods are booked under this ID number with specification of the volume or quantity, order number, format and grammage, etc.
The two labels offer redundancy and ensure that pallets will be detected by the RFID antennae, regardless of the direction in which it is transported.
PileTronic allows pile logistics to be managed 100% automatically, with full electronic tracking documentation. kba-usa.com
